Isaac de León Beltrán
Isaac de León Beltrán is an agent of the Unidad de Información y Análisis Financiero (Uiaf) in Colombia. He has recently been in the news due to his involvement in a controversial meeting with Diego Marín, alias 'Papá Pitufo,' which was reportedly at the instruction of President Gustavo Petro. This meeting was scrutinized as it centered around offering a financial amnesty in exchange for information, highlighting ongoing concerns regarding corruption and financial practices within major Colombian institutions.
